Output 2cf21c94f0991244f9f64a70e61303ea56ab33830f12938edce524c9e42f0cd3:13

value
343559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92e8651c972e72a544337a86b48378fb0c6c133 OP_EQUAL
address
3H7ZrZ8yhZyby6uA2qbvzuf6o2MsV7T5Qp
transaction
2cf21c94f0991244f9f64a70e61303ea56ab33830f12938edce524c9e42f0cd3
spent
true